Weather Overview in Tomar

Tomar enjoys a Mediterranean climate with mild, wet winters and hot, dry summers. Annual average temperature is 15°C (59°F), with 784 mm of rainfall mostly from October to March. Summers peak at 29°C (84°F) in July, while January averages 11°C (52°F). Extremes include 42°C (108°F) highs and -4°C (25°F) lows. This weather at Instituto Politécnico de Tomar supports year-round outdoor learning but requires preparation for seasonal shifts. Sunshine averages 2,700 hours yearly, ideal for campus life. Seasonal Weather Patterns at Instituto Politécnico de Tomar

Spring (Mar-May)

Temperatures rise to 20°C (68°F), with moderate rain (100 mm/month). Flowers bloom, perfect for campus events. Pack light jackets.

Summer (Jun-Aug)

Hot and dry, 29°C (84°F) highs, minimal rain. Wildfire risk increases; university advises hydration. Air conditioning recommended.

Autumn (Sep-Nov)

Mild 22°C (72°F), increasing rain (150 mm). Windy days; prepare umbrellas for walks to classes.

Winter (Dec-Feb)

Cool 13°C (55°F), wettest season (200 mm rain). Rare frost; heating costs rise 20-30%. Instituto Politécnico de Tomar has indoor facilities.

Environmental Factors in Tomar

At 59m altitude, Tomar has stable geology with sedimentary rocks, no volcanic activity. Air quality is excellent (AQI 20-50), low pollution from light industry. 🌳 Green spaces like parks improve health, reducing respiratory issues. Instituto Politécnico de Tomar promotes sustainability. Tomar air quality supports active lifestyles, though summer dust can affect allergies. University health services monitor conditions.
